About

The name of the restaurant, which comes from the Spanish verb “cocinar” (to cook), says it all as Yolanda León and Juanjo Pérez met while working together in different kitchens before they decided to come together to pursue a shared dream. The unexpectedly modern interior of the historic Casa del Peregrino (1750), next to the monumental Parador-Hostal de San Marcos, provides the backdrop for cuisine with an identity that stems from transparency. The creatively inspired cuisine here is centred around two tasting menus (Cocinar León and Gran Menú Cocinandos) which tell a story, are based around the best local ingredients, and evolve weekly in line with the seasons, accompanied by the region’s best wines. To enhance your experience further, enjoy a coffee in the garden, overlooked on one side by the historic San Marcos church and on the other by the city’s concert hall. During the summer months, a “Menú Parrilla”, designed for sharing, is also available in this delightful space.
